Total Syntheses of 3- epi-Litsenolide D2 and Lincomolide A
Noriki Kutsumura1,2, Akito Kiriseko2, Kentaro Niwa2
1International Institute for Integrative Sleep Medicine (WPI-IIIS) , University of Tsukuba , 1-1-1 Tennodai , Tsukuba , Ibaraki 305-8575 , Japan.
Abstract:
The first total syntheses of 3- epi-litsenolide D2 and its enantiomer lincomolide A were achieved. The synthetic highlights of our approach include olefin cross metathesis and bromine addition to the generated double bond, followed by the regioselective HBr-elimination and intramolecular carbonylation using bis(triphenylphosphine)dicarbonylnickel. This investigation also revealed that the previously reported specific optical rotation of 3- epi-litsenolide D2 should be revised.
